Positive Psychology: Cultivating Strengths & Meaning

Positive Psychology isn’t about ignoring life’s challenges—it’s about building the skills and mindset to thrive despite them. Rooted in evidence-based practices, this approach focuses on:

  • Identifying and amplifying your strengths (not just fixing what’s “broken”).
  • Fostering hope, meaning, and purpose in daily life, even during transitions or adversity.
  • Developing practical tools for resilience, gratitude, and values-aligned action.

In our work together, we’ll use techniques from Positive Psychology to help you:

  • Shift from surviving to thriving by recognizing what’s already working in your life.
  • Cultivate self-compassion and sustainable habits for long-term well-being.
  • Create a life that feels authentic and fulfilling, grounded in your core values.

Perfect for those ready to move beyond coping—and toward growth, agency, and joy.
